Why Berlin's Street Art is Unique
Berlin's history as a divided city has created a unique canvas for artistic expression. The Berlin Wall, once a symbol of division, now stands as the world's largest open-air gallery at the East Side Gallery. In 2026, the city continues to embrace street art as a form of cultural expression and social commentary.
Top Street Art Locations in Berlin 2026
1. East Side Gallery
The most famous stretch of the Berlin Wall features over 100 paintings by artists from around the world. In 2026, several sections have been refreshed with new artworks while preserving the historical significance.
2. Kreuzberg
This vibrant neighborhood remains the heart of Berlin's street art scene. Wander through Oranienstraße, Mariannenstraße, and around Görlitzer Park to discover ever-changing murals and graffiti.
3. Friedrichshain
Adjacent to Kreuzberg, Friedrichshain offers more street art treasures, particularly around Boxhagener Platz and along the Spree River.
4. Mitte
Berlin's central district features a mix of commissioned murals and spontaneous graffiti, with notable pieces around Hackescher Markt and Rosenthaler Platz.
5. Teufelsberg
For those willing to venture further, this abandoned Cold War listening station features large-scale artworks in a unique setting.
